About Us DNPA is the body that oversees the vibrant, living, working landscape and community that is Dartmoor. We help to conserve and enhance the biodiversity, cultural heritage and landscape of Dartmoor and provide opportunities for people to enjoy the countryside, as well as supporting our local communities and the rural economy. About the Walkham Valley Landscape Recovery Scheme (WVLR) The Walkham catchment is a tributary of the River Tamar on the western side of the moor that hosts an incredible array of habitats and species, as well as a rich historical and cultural heritage. Landscape Recovery is the new, innovative upper tier of the Government Environment Land Management Scheme (ELMS) that aims to achieve landscape-scale and coherent ecological restoration through a collaborative long-term approach. The WVLR is a farmer and landowner-led initiative which is currently in a two-year development phase exploring options that will culminate in an agreed and costed business plan to support long-term environmental enhancement and business resilience across the scheme area. This will lead to an exciting 20-year delivery phase that will provide the support, resources and funding to deliver a vision developed and owned principally by those who live and work in the Valley.
